Tradewind Recruitment are currently seeking exceptional Part-Time Behaviour Mentors to work across secondary SEMH schools throughout Enfield. These specialist settings support vulnerable students with complex SEMH needs who require expert behavioural and emotional intervention to unlock their educational potential. We have flexible part-time positions available (2-4 days per week) starting now with excellent prospects for permanent placements. As a Behaviour Mentor you will be responsible for: 1 to 1 and classroom support Delivering behavioural interventions for secondary students with SEMH needs Running individual and small group mentoring sessions De-escalating crisis situations and providing trauma-informed support Building positive relationships to inspire student engagement and progress Working with teams, families, and external agencies Recording behavioural observations and tracking progress Supporting learning while addressing behavioural barriers To excel in this role you will need: Experience working with secondary students with SEMH needs Knowledge of behaviour management and de-escalation techniques Emotional resilience and ability to remain calm under pressure Enhanced DBS Disclosure and professional references Full employment history for the previous 10 years Right to work in the UK What we offer: Daily rate: £90 - £140 (increased after 12 weeks in role) Flexible working: 2-4 days per week to suit your availability Tradewind offers highly competitive daily rates with clear progression pathways, comprehensive CPD training programs, generous referral bonuses, and regular professional networking events.
